The Navajo Indian reservation is home to many strange creatures. One creature called The Howler, is a mysterious creature believed to have killed dogs and livestock. Elders in the community call these predators Skinwalkers, while others call it the Navajo version of Bigfoot. The reservation even has a special law enforcement agency that only responds to paranormal reports such as ghosts, witchcraft, UFOs and even Bigfoot. With the recent photo that surfaced a few days ago, you can bet this group of elite paranormal officers are already on the case.

